Ask your audience to do ‘one thing’ or encourage them to do ‘one thing’ over multiple days! Feel free to use these prompts or create your own!

  1. Check your credit report
  2. Pay a bill
  3. Ask a friend their favourite way to save money
  4. Talk to a senior about financial fraud
  5. Talk to your parent about their retirement plan
  6. Try Loud Budgeting
  7. Compare credit cards
  8. Put money into an emergency fund
  9. Track your monthly expenses
  10. Create a budget
  11. Chat with a friend about how much you spend on holiday gifts
  12. Discuss with a friend how much would you spend on a wedding gift
  13. Watch a video or read an article about financial literacy
